AIKEN, S.C. —
An Aiken, South Carolina, woman has been accused of falsely reporting her car as stolen.
According to the arrest warrant, Dearra Lashay Griffin submitted a false claim to GEICO Indemnity Company on July 10, 2023. Griffin reported to GEICO that her 2017 Kia Sportage was stolen from Interstate 20, near mile marker 33 on July 9, 2023.
GEICO was contacted by a local repair facility and advised that the insured vehicle had been on the repair facility's lot since July 6, 2023.
Griffin admitted to investigators that she falsely reported the claim to GEICO due to mechanical issues with the vehicle.
The South Carolina Law Enforcement Division said that Griffin received $15,010 from the false claim.
